Sony has released three new images from David Fincher's The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o.  According to Fincher, his take on the film explores "the cultural legacy of denial," and "we want to find a place where you can talk about something and be really, really hard-hitting - like the material it's based on - and yet we also want to make it a moviegoing experience."  I haven't read the book but the Swedish adaptation didn't seem like it had much to say about anything.  It was simply a detective story with some colorful but meaningless brutality thrown in.  I give Fincher the benefit of the doubt that he can glean a more rewarding film from Stieg Larsson's novel.

Hit the jump to check out the images.  The film stars Daniel Craig and Rooney Mara.  The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o opens December 21st.
